Resetting an Explore 4 machine involves restoring its original functionality, allowing it to function normally again. This method is helpful when the machine isn’t working properly, like not cutting or responding. When you reset the machine, it will revert to its default settings aand resume working as intended. However, there is no physical reset button on the Explore 4, but there are alternative methods to reset it.

Method 1: Soft Reset

This is the primary method to reset an Explore 4 machine. Use it for minor problems, such as when the machine freezes and doesn’t respond. 

  1. Power off your Cricut Explore 4 by pressing the power button on it.
  2. Disconnect the machine’s power cord from the power outlet.
  3. Wait 1-2 minutes, then reconnect the power cord.
  4. Press and hold the power button on the machine to restart it.

Method 2: Factory Reset or Hard Reset

This method is used to address the major problems with Explore 4, including cutting issues, calibration problems, and repeated connectivity failures. Use these steps to perform a factory reset:

  1. Press and hold the power button on the Explore 4 to turn it off.
  2. Hold the Load/Unload button, pause button, and press the power button simultaneously.
  3. Continue holding the buttons until the machine’s light flashes once, and then slowly release them.

Finally, the machine will restart and get back to its original state. However, a reset is not always a smooth process. Sometimes, it might show problems such as power issues, loss of Bluetooth connection, firmware update fails, etc.

Problem 1: Explore 4 Doesn’t Turn On After a Reset

Cricut Explore 4 not turning on after a reset is a common problem users face. It usually happens due to connection failures. Fix it by using these troubleshooting steps.

  1. Connect another device to the power outlet to verify that it’s working properly.
  2. Disconnect the power cord from the machine and the power outlet, and reconnect it after 1-2 minutes.
  3. Use a different power outlet to connect the machine. Sometimes, the problem lies in the power socket.

Problem 2: Bluetooth Connection Failed

When the Cricut Explore 4 machine gets back to its original settings, the Bluetooth connection may fail. In this situation, reconnect the machine via Bluetooth using these steps:

  1. Click the Windows icon on the computer’s taskbar at the bottom left.
  2. Search for Settings in the given field, and select the Bluetooth & Devices option.
  3. Click the “Add Device” option and select “Bluetooth” as the connection type.
  4. Select your Cricut Explore 4 machine, and enter “0000” if it asks for a passcode.

Problem 3: Firmware Update Required

Sometimes, a reset of the Cricut Explore 4 requires a firmware update. It is a common error that most users face. However, it can be resolved by simply updating the firmware using these steps:

  1. Open the Design Space on the computer, and click the menu (three horizontal lines) in the top left corner.
  2. Click the “Update Firmware” option and select your Cricut Explore 4 machine.
  3. When you see an update available, click on it and let it process.
  4. A percentage bar will appear showing the progress of the update; let it finish.
